Haven't seen klauncher but there are several ways to run
programs in DQSD  

1) use the run command built into dqsd. ie: run taskmgr will
do the same thing as opening the run dialog and typing in
taskmgr

2) use localaliases.txt in the DQSD installation directory
or on the menu at Configure -> Local Aliases to make your
own shortcuts to take advantage of all the built in commands.

3) check out the Quick Launch and Desktop add-ons at
http://www.brentlysoftware.com/dqsdaddons and have your
quick launch and desktop icons show up as menu items in the
DQSD popup menu
